
Security gates and burglar bars are standard in Bloemfontein homes, but many installations don't comply with building regulations. The non-compliant ones can trap occupants during a fire. Here is what the rules require and how to check.
The regulation homeowners get wrong most often
SANS 10400 (the national building standard) requires that at least one window in every bedroom have an openable section or a quick-release mechanism that allows occupants to escape in a fire. Burglar bars that are welded or bolted shut over every bedroom window are non-compliant, a fire risk, and a potential insurance issue.
What a compliant installation looks like
Bedroom burglar bars must have at least one panel with a hinged, sliding or removable section operated from inside without tools. Security gates in passageways used as escape routes need a key or a thumb-turn lock operable from inside. Insurance implications
If a fire occurs and investigation shows the property's security bars blocked egress, your insurer may challenge a claim. Compliance is not just about regulations, it protects your cover.
What to check in your home
Go through each bedroom and confirm there is at least one burglar bar panel or window section that opens from inside without a key. Check passage security gates for interior operation. If anything doesn't comply, it's a straightforward repair or addition for our team.

Does every window in every room need an opening panel?
No, SANS requires at least one openable window or quick-release panel per bedroom. Living areas and bathrooms have different requirements.
Can you add a quick-release mechanism to existing burglar bars?
Yes. In most cases we can add a hinged panel or quick-release section to existing bars without replacing the whole frame.
